Why Is My Acer Dying? The Complete UK Diagnostic Guide
Lee Burkhill: Award Winning Designer & BBC 1's Garden Rescue Presenters Official Blog
An acer in trouble is one of the most common questions I get asked, both through this site and out on client site visits. Whether it is a young Acer palmatum in a pot on a balcony or a mature specimen that has been the centrepiece of a border for twenty years, the panic is always the same from garden clients. Crisping leaves, bare patches, or a tree that simply looks like it has given up. This guide will help you identify the cause and the fix!
Quick Answer
Acers most often die or decline in UK gardens because of leaf scorch from drying wind, hot sun or drought, which is environmental rather than a disease and is by far the commonest cause. Late spring frost damaging tender new growth, a container that has become root bound and dries out faster than the tree can cope with, and waterlogged soil are the next most frequent culprits. The one seriously damaging disease to rule out is verticillium wilt, a soil-borne fungus with no cure that kills one branch or one side of the tree at a time. Get your acer out of exposed wind, into free-draining soil or a large enough pot, and shaded from the harshest afternoon sun, and most other problems resolve themselves.
The good news, having diagnosed hundreds of these over thirty years of gardening and fifteen years of professional design work, is that the overwhelming majority of struggling acers are suffering from one of a small handful of causes, and almost all of them are fixable if you catch them in time. This guide walks through every genuine cause of a dying or declining Acer, how to tell them apart, and exactly what to do about each one.

Acers, or Japanese maples as many of the ornamental varieties are commonly known, have a reputation for being fussy. In my experience, that reputation is not justifiable, and usually their fussiness is just being planted in the wrong conditions!
Most Acer palmatum cultivars are quite tough once they are sited correctly, and the vast majority of problems I get photos of trace back to where the tree is planted rather than to anything wrong with the plant itself. Wind, sun, drought, frost and a container that has become too small are behind the great majority of cases, well ahead of any pest or disease. Get the position and the watering right, and most acres are remarkably resilient.

Acer at a Glance
Before diagnosing a specific problem, it helps to know what a healthy Acer actually needs. Most of the diagnostic work below comes back to one of these baseline requirements not being met.
| Botanical Name | Acer palmatum and related species |
| Plant Type | Deciduous ornamental tree or large shrub |
| RHS Hardiness | H5 to H6, fully hardy in most of the UK |
| Height and Spread | Varies hugely by cultivar, from 1m dwarf forms to 8m specimen trees |
| Preferred Position | Dappled shade or morning sun, sheltered from strong wind and afternoon heat |
| Soil | Moist but free-draining, slightly acidic to neutral, never waterlogged |
| Key Vulnerability | Leaf scorch from wind, sun and drought, worse in containers |
How to Diagnose Your Acer
Before reaching for a fungicide or worrying the tree is beyond saving, use this table to match what you are actually seeing against the most likely cause. I have ordered it roughly by how often each one comes up in the questions I get sent, from everyday to rare.
| What you see | Most likely cause | Jump to |
|---|---|---|
| Brown, crispy, curled edges on leaves right across the tree, usually in June to August | Leaf scorch from wind, sun or drought | Section 3 |
| New spring growth suddenly blackened, shrivelled or hanging limp after a cold night | Late frost damage | Section 4 |
| Potted acer wilting daily despite watering, compost that dries out within a day or two, roots visible circling the pot | Root-bound container, too small for the tree | Section 5 |
| Yellowing leaves, black or mushy roots, soil that stays wet for days after rain | Waterlogging and poor drainage | Section 6 |
| One branch, or one whole side of the tree, dying back while the rest stays green; dark streaking inside the wood if you cut a dead stem | Verticillium wilt | Section 7 |
| Neat U-shaped notches eaten from leaf edges, or a container plant collapsing suddenly with roots eaten away | Vine weevil, adults and larvae | Section 8 |
| Raised black or dark green tar-like spots on otherwise healthy leaves in late summer | Tar spot, cosmetic only | Section 9 |
| Scorching that only appears near a recently fed or gritted path, or after a very salty coastal spell | Salt or fertiliser scorch | Section 10 |
| Leaves turning red, orange or yellow and dropping in September or October, otherwise looking healthy | Completely normal autumn colour change | Section 11 |

Leaf Scorch: Wind, Sun and Drought
This is by far the most common reason an Acer looks like it is dying, and it leads to all the emails in my inbox. The truth is, it very rarely is. Leaf scorch appears as brown, crispy, curled edges on leaves, sometimes spreading until the whole leaf is affected, usually occurring from June to August during hot spells.
It is an environmental response rather than a disease. The tree is losing water through its leaves faster than the roots can replace it, whether because the roots are too dry, the air is too dry, or both.
Japanese maples in particular have thin, delicate leaves that were bred for the dappled shade of a woodland floor, and they simply cannot cope with the combination of strong wind and full afternoon sun the way a tougher, thicker-leaved shrub can.

Wind is the factor people underestimate most, and it is one I bring up on almost every client visit where an Acer has struggled. I have lost count of the number of gardens I have designed for, or been called out to advise on, where a beautiful Acer has been planted at the exact point where wind funnels between two houses, along a side return, or through a gap in a fence line, and nobody realised until the leaves started shredding every summer.
A wind pocket like that does not need to be a coastal gale. Even a fairly gentle, constant draught through a narrow gap between buildings will dry a Japanese maple out far faster than the same wind moving freely across an open lawn, because the air is being funnelled and accelerated rather than dispersing.
On one project in a terraced garden, we moved a struggling Bloodgood Acer barely two metres, from a gap between the house and a boundary wall into a sheltered corner behind a low hedge, and the scorch that had plagued it every August simply stopped the following year. The tree had not changed, but its position in relation to the wind exposure had.

The fix depends on how established the tree is. A young or container-grown Acer in an exposed spot is worth moving to shelter, ideally in late Autumn or winter while it is dormant. My full guide on how to move an established Acer tree without killing it covers the process step by step.
If moving is not practical, a temporary or permanent windbreak makes a real difference. Something as simple as a hessian screen or a row of taller shrubs planted to the windward side will take the worst of it off a vulnerable tree.
For the height of a scorching spell, I keep a roll of heavy-duty plant protection fleece to hand for exactly this, draping it loosely on the windward side rather than wrapping the whole tree. The same goes for heavy frost in more northern gardens; I always fleece Acers in containers during super heavy snow or frost.

Drought is the other half of the equation, and it compounds wind exposure rather than acting separately from it. An Acer that is dry at the roots has less water in reserve to cope with a windy or sunny spell, so the two often turn up together in the same tree at the same time.
Watering deeply once or twice a week in dry weather, rather than a light daily sprinkle that only wets the surface, encourages the roots to grow down rather than staying shallow and vulnerable. A thick mulch of composted bark or leaf mould over the root zone, kept clear of the trunk itself, retains moisture in the soil for much longer between waterings.

Scorched leaves themselves will not recover once the brown has set in, but they are rarely the whole story. Provided the buds and stems underneath are still green and pliable, the tree is very likely to reshoot normally the following spring once the underlying position or watering issue is addressed.
Resist the urge to strip off every scorched leaf. Leave them until they drop naturally, since the tree is still drawing some benefit from them even in that state.
Frost Damage on Spring Growth
Acers are among the first trees to break bud in spring, often as early as March, and that early, soft new growth is particularly tender. A late frost, the kind that can still catch a UK garden well into April or even early May in a cold year, will blacken and shrivel that new growth within a single night.
It looks alarming, often far worse than leaf scorch, because it can affect the whole flush of new leaves at once rather than just the edges. The good news is that this is almost always cosmetic rather than fatal.
The tree has simply lost its first attempt at leaves, and in the great majority of cases it will push a second flush within a few weeks once the frost risk has passed.

Frost pockets are one of the most common siting mistakes I see when advising clients on where to plant an Acer, and they are surprisingly easy to create without realising it. Cold air is heavier than warm air and flows downhill exactly like water, settling and pooling at the lowest point it can reach.
A dip in the lawn, the base of a slope, or even just the low corner where two boundary fences meet can sit several degrees colder on a clear, still night than a spot only a few metres away that is slightly higher or more open. I have walked gardens on a frosty February morning, where you can see the exact line the cold air has settled along, frost thick on one half of the lawn and barely a trace on the other.
An Acer planted right in that low pocket will take the hardest frost hit in the whole garden, every single year, while an identical tree a few steps away on higher ground escapes almost unscathed.
If your Acer sits in a known frost pocket and gets caught most springs, the most reliable long-term fix is the same as for wind exposure: move it, ideally to slightly higher ground or a spot with some overhead canopy from a larger tree, which breaks up radiant frost far more effectively than a solid wall or fence does.

Where moving is not an option, keep an eye on the forecast through March and April and throw fleece over the newest growth on any night a hard frost is predicted, removing it again once temperatures lift the next day.
Established trees with woody, hardened growth from previous years are far more frost tolerant than the current season’s soft new leaves, so it is really only that first flush each spring that needs the protection.
Container Acers: Root-Bound and Drying Out
Acers are among the most popular container trees in the UK, which makes sense given that many of the smaller cultivars are bred specifically for pot culture. It also means that a large proportion of the struggling Acer photographs I get sent are of container plants.
The underlying cause is nearly always the same: the pot has become too small for the roots inside it, commonly called being pot-bound or root-bound, and the compost is drying out faster than the tree can draw water from it.

This is one of the most common problems I come across, both in questions sent to me and out on client gardens: a lovely, established Acer left in a tiny container for years, quietly outgrowing it while nobody notices until the tree starts to fail every summer.
I have seen this on more than one design consultation: a client who has inherited a mature Acer palmatum in a decorative pot from a previous owner, or bought a beautiful specimen years ago and simply never got round to sizing it up as it grew.
The roots eventually fill every available space, circle round the inside of the pot, and pack the compost so tightly that water runs straight through without the roots ever getting a proper chance to absorb it. A tree in that state can look bone dry within a day of watering even in mild weather, because there is barely any actual soil volume left between the roots to hold moisture.
It is not the tree being difficult. It is simply outgrown its home.
The tell-tale signs are worth knowing. Lift the pot slightly and check whether roots are emerging from the drainage holes at the base. Water that runs straight through and out the bottom within seconds of being poured on, rather than being absorbed, is another strong indicator.
If you can see roots visibly circling at the surface of the compost, or the tree needs watering every single day just to stay upright during a warm spell, it is time to repot.
The general rule I give clients is to size up every two to three years for a young, actively growing Acer, moving into a pot roughly a third larger each time, then settle into a longer cycle of five or so years once the tree reaches a size you are happy to keep.
When repotting, resist the temptation to jump to an enormous pot in one go. Too much compost volume around a small root ball actually works against the tree, since the roots cannot draw moisture from soil they have not yet grown into, and that excess wet compost around the edges is a real risk factor for root rot.
A loam-based compost gives acers the best of both worlds in a container, holding moisture reliably without becoming permanently sodden, and I use the John Innes and BBC Gardeners’ World recommendation of a fifty-fifty mix with an ericaceous compost for potted specimens.

If root pruning is needed to fit a truly pot-bound tree back into the same-size container, do not panic. It sounds drastic, but acers respond well to it.
Gently tease the roots free at the edges, trim back congested or circling roots by a third with clean, sharp secateurs, and refresh the compost around the root ball before replanting at the same depth. The tree will put on fresh feeder roots in response within a few weeks, provided it is kept consistently watered while it recovers, and root pruning done this way at the right time of year rarely sets an Acer back for long.
Waterlogging and Poor Drainage
Less common than drought but every bit as damaging, waterlogging affects acers planted in heavy clay soil, low-lying ground, or any container without adequate drainage. Roots need oxygen as well as water, and soil that stays saturated for days after rain effectively suffocates them, leading to root rot.
The above-ground symptoms can look confusingly similar to drought at first glance, with yellowing leaves and a generally sickly appearance. This is exactly why the soil probe mentioned earlier in this guide earns its keep: a quick check of the compost or the ground around the roots immediately tells you whether you are dealing with too little water or too much.
For a border Acer in heavy clay, improving drainage before planting is far easier than trying to fix it afterwards: work plenty of horticultural grit and organic matter into the planting hole and, ideally, raise the tree slightly on a mound so the root flare sits a touch proud of the surrounding soil level.
For an already-planted tree showing signs of waterlogging, digging a soakaway or French drain nearby can help relieve standing water, though in persistently boggy ground the more realistic long-term solution is usually to move the tree to a better-drained spot or use a raised bed or large container instead. In containers, waterlogging is almost always down to blocked or insufficient drainage holes, or a saucer left to fill with water after rain, both of which are simple to correct.
Verticillium Wilt: The Serious Disease to Rule Out
This is the one genuine disease worth ruling out before assuming an Acer’s problems are purely environmental, and it is the reason I always ask for a photograph of the whole tree rather than just a close-up of the affected leaves. Verticillium wilt is a soil-borne fungal disease, and acers are among the plants in which the RHS records it most frequently, alongside Cotinus and Catalpa.
The fungus enters through the roots and blocks the water-conducting tissue inside the stem, producing a very distinctive symptom: one branch, or one entire side of the tree, dies back while the rest remains perfectly healthy and green. This asymmetric, one-sided pattern is the key thing that separates verticillium from drought or leaf scorch, both of which tend to affect the whole tree fairly evenly.

To check for it, cut through a small dead or dying stem and look at the cut face. Verticillium shows as dark brown or olive streaking in a ring just under the bark, visible as discoloured marks around the circumference of the cut wood.
There is no chemical cure for Verticillium wilt once it is established, which is the hard truth of this diagnosis, but it does not necessarily mean the whole tree is lost. Prune out affected branches promptly, cutting well back into clean, unstained wood, and disinfect your secateurs or loppers between cuts to avoid spreading the fungus to healthy parts of the tree.
Keep the tree well-fed and well-watered to help it fight the infection, and be aware that the fungus persists in the soil for years, so avoid replanting another Acer or any other susceptible species in exactly the same spot if the tree is eventually lost.
Vine Weevil and Root Damage
Vine weevil is far better known as a container plant pest than a serious problem for border acers, but a potted specimen can absolutely fall victim to it. Adult vine weevils feed on the leaves at night, leaving the tell-tale neat, U-shaped notches along the leaf edges, which is unsightly but rarely serious on its own.
The real damage is done below ground by the larvae, cream-coloured grubs with distinct brown heads, which feed on the roots through Autumn and winter. A container Acer that suddenly wilts and collapses despite being well watered, particularly if this happens in late winter or early spring, is worth tipping out of its pot to check the root ball for grubs and root damage before assuming drought is the cause.

Nematodes are by far the most effective and reliably safe treatment: naturally occurring microscopic worms that seek out and kill vine weevil larvae in the soil without harming the plant, pets, or wildlife. They need to be applied to moist compost when the soil temperature is consistently above about five degrees, typically March to October outdoors.

Tar Spot and Other Cosmetic Leaf Marks
Tar spot is a fungal disease that appears as raised, black or very dark green spots on the leaf surface, usually in late summer, looking exactly as the name suggests, as though someone has flicked spots of tar across the foliage. It looks worrying but is almost entirely cosmetic and causes no meaningful harm to the tree’s health or vigour.
It thrives in damp, still conditions and spreads via fallen leaves, so the only real management step worth taking is raking up and disposing of affected leaves in Autumn rather than composting them, which reduces the number of fungal spores overwintering and ready to reinfect the tree the following year. No fungicide treatment is necessary or, in most garden settings, practical.
Salt and Fertiliser Scorch
Two specific, easily missed causes are worth flagging on their own, since they closely mimic ordinary leaf scorch and can be mistaken for it. Salt scorch appears on acers planted close to a road that gets gritted in winter, or in coastal gardens exposed to salt-laden wind.
It shows as browning concentrated on the side of the tree facing the road or the sea rather than spread evenly across the whole canopy, which is the giveaway that distinguishes it from drought or general wind scorch. There is no cure beyond rinsing foliage with fresh water after a heavy salting and, where possible, siting new acers away from the worst of the exposure.
Fertiliser scorch is the other easily overlooked cause, and it is almost always a case of good intentions causing the problem. Acers are not hungry plants and need very little supplementary feeding, particularly if they are already mulched annually with good compost. A strong liquid feed applied too concentrated, or granular fertiliser that lands directly against the trunk or root flare rather than being evenly spread, can burn the fine feeder roots and cause leaf browning within days of application. If you suspect this, water the area thoroughly and deeply to dilute and flush the excess fertiliser through the soil, and hold off feeding again for the rest of the season.
Is This a Real Problem, or Just Autumn?
I get sent a genuine number of photographs every September and October of acers that are not dying at all, simply doing exactly what a deciduous tree is meant to do. Acers are grown, in no small part, for their Autumn colour, and a leaf turning brilliant red, orange, or gold before dropping is the tree performing beautifully rather than failing.
The distinction that matters is timing and pattern. Colour change that arrives on schedule for the season, spreads evenly across the whole tree rather than concentrating on one branch, and is not accompanied by premature leaf drop in high summer, is completely normal and nothing to worry about.

What does warrant investigation is colour change or leaf loss that arrives well out of season, in June or July rather than September, or that is patchy and asymmetric rather than affecting the whole tree together. That pattern points back to one of the causes covered earlier in this guide, most likely leaf scorch, drought, or, in more serious cases, verticillium wilt, rather than the tree simply entering its Autumn display early.
Step by Step: Reviving a Struggling Acer
Whichever cause applies to your tree, the sequence below is the same one I work through on a client visit, in the order I check it.
Step 1: Check the soil or compost
Push a finger, or a soil probe, several centimetres into the ground or compost. Bone-dry points to drought or a root-bound container. Consistently sodden points towards waterlogging of your Acer, which they HATE. This single check rules out or confirms two of the most common causes before you do anything else, and it takes all of 30 seconds, Ninjas.

Step 2: Assess the position
Stand where the tree is and honestly assess whether it sits in a wind funnel, in full, unbroken afternoon sun, or in a low frost pocket. If the area your Acer is in is challenging or you wouldn’t want to sit there yourself, then it’s time to move the tree. Plan to move your Acer in Autumn or winter, when it is dormant.
Step 3: Remove dead and affected wood
Using clean, sharp secateurs, cut back any branches that are brittle and snap rather than bend, back to healthy green tissue and a live bud. Disinfect blades between cuts if verticillium wilt is suspected. If you have never pruned anything before, do check out my guide here first.
Acers are best pruned in late Autumn or winter while dormant, since cutting in spring or summer causes heavy sap bleeding; my guide on whether you can prune trees in winter covers the reasoning in more detail.

Step 4: Mulch generously
Mulch is your best friend with struggling Acers or any plant for that matter! Apply five to eight centimetres of composted bark or leaf mould over the root zone, kept clear of the trunk itself, for a border Acer. This locks in soil moisture, buffers root temperature, and gradually improves soil structure, addressing several causes on this page at once.

Step 5: Water deeply and consistently
Water thoroughly once or twice a week in dry spells rather than little and often. For a container Acer, water until it runs freely from the drainage holes, which also confirms those holes are not blocked.
Step 6: Be patient
Once the underlying cause is addressed, allow a full growing season for the tree to recover before judging whether it has worked. Scorched or frost-damaged leaves will not repair themselves, but new growth the following spring is the real test, and most acers reward patience.
Frequently Asked Questions
Can an Acer come back to life?
Yes, in the great majority of cases. Provided the main stems are still green and pliable under the bark rather than dry and brittle all the way through, an Acer that looks dead in spring after a hard winter or a scorching summer will very often reshoot from live buds lower down. Scratch a small patch of bark with a fingernail; green underneath means the wood is alive.
How do you revive a dying Acer tree?
Identify the underlying cause using the diagnosis table earlier in this guide, then work through the six-step revival sequence: check the soil, assess the position for wind and frost exposure, remove dead wood, mulch generously, water deeply and consistently, and allow a full growing season for the tree to respond.
Why have my potted Acer’s leaves shrivelled?
Shrivelled leaves on a container Acer are almost always a sign that the pot has become root-bound and is drying out faster than the roots can keep up, particularly in warm weather. Check whether roots are visible at the drainage holes or circling at the compost surface, and size the container up if so.
What does Acer dieback look like?
Genuine dieback from verticillium wilt shows as one branch or one side of the tree dying while the rest stays healthy, with dark streaking visible under the bark if you cut a dead stem. This asymmetric, one-sided pattern is the key thing that separates it from drought or leaf scorch, both of which affect the whole tree fairly evenly.
Do acers like full sun or shade?
Most Japanese maples do best in dappled shade or morning sun with shelter from strong wind and the harshest afternoon heat, which mimics the woodland conditions they evolved in. A handful of tougher, larger-leaved species tolerate more sun, but as a general rule, protection from the hottest part of the day markedly reduces the risk of leaf scorch.
How do I know if my Acer’s roots are damaged?
Signs of root damage include a container plant that wilts within a day of watering, regardless of the weather; roots visibly circling the compost surface or emerging from drainage holes; or a sudden collapse after a period of otherwise normal growth, which can point to vine weevil grub damage. Gently tipping the plant out of its pot to inspect the root ball directly is the most reliable way to confirm it.

Summary
Most struggling acers are suffering from environmental factors rather than disease, and leaf scorch from wind, sun, and drought accounts for the majority of cases I get asked about, closely followed by frost damage to spring growth and containers that have quietly become too small.
Work through the diagnosis table, check the soil first, and be honest about whether your tree is sitting in a wind funnel or a frost pocket, since those two siting mistakes explain more struggling Acers than almost anything else I see on client visits.
Verticillium wilt is the one cause that truly has no cure, but it is also rare, and the one-sided dieback pattern makes it straightforward to rule in or out. For everything else on this page, patience, the right position, and consistent watering will bring back the great majority of acers.
